Jennifer Lawrence and Josh Hutcherson are reportedly returning to the Hunger Games franchise. The actors will appear in Lionsgate’s upcoming prequel, The Hunger Games: Sunrise on the Reaping, which will also be their first on-screen reunion as Katniss Everdeen and Peeta Mellark since the original films ended.
Jennifer Lawrence and Josh Hutcherson will appear in The Hunger Games: Sunrise on the Reaping
While The Hunger Games: Sunrise on the Reaping is set 24 years before Katniss Everdeen volunteers as a tribute, the film will cleverly incorporate its veteran stars, Jennifer Lawrence and Josh Hutcherson, Deadline confirmed.
The plot finds a narrative bridge through the new Suzanne Collins book, which features a scene where an adult Katniss and Peeta listen as Haymitch Abernathy recounts his own harrowing experience in the arena. This framing device allows the Oscar-winning Lawrence and fan-favorite Hutcherson to return without disrupting the prequel’s timeline, also giving a glimpse into their characters’ future.
The prequel itself follows a 16-year-old Haymitch, played by Joseph Zada. The story begins on the morning of the reaping for the 50th Hunger Games, aka the Second Quarter Quell. This edition infamously forces 48 tributes into the arena, where the clever District 12 boy must fight to survive and ultimately become the future mentor to Katniss and Peeta.
Directed by franchise veteran Francis Lawrence, the film is already getting a lot of buzz. Its first teaser trailer scored 109 million views in 24 hours. Further, the latest confirmation ends months of speculation.

The Hunger Games: Sunrise on the Reaping is set to release on November 20, 2026.
